Gas production from Sangomar will provide the energy needed to power a plant with a capacity of between 350 and 590 MW, while the St. Louis offshore block could power a 250 MW plant. To reduce production costs, existing plants will be converted to dual fuel/gas while new plants will be built using natural gas-fired combined cycle (CCGT).
In 2022, Senegal spent almost 4% of its gross domestic product (GDP) on energy subsidies. The government pledge to reduce this share to 1% by 2025 is a major and welcome reform commitment. The IEA’s Energy Policy Review of Senegal 2023, published today, finds that energy is at the heart of Senegal’s 2035 strategy for accelerating sustainable development and economic growth known as the Plan Sénégal Émergent (PSE), or the Emerging Senegal Plan.
As mentioned above, Senegal is implementing a gas to power program in the energy sector. The purpose of the program is to convert existing thermal power plants to dual-fuel and to build future thermal power plants using natural gas as a primary energy source.
Senegal’s power sector would be strengthened by continued diversified investment in power, including renewables and natural gas, while phasing out heavy fuel oil. Senegal Energy Outlook - Analysis and findings. An article by the International Energy Agency.
Senegal has major ambitions to use domestic gas resources to generate electricity through its “gas--to--power” strategy decided in 2018, which aims to reduce national energy dependence on oil and coal by incentivising investment in natural gas as a transitory fuel in the energy transition.
